ALFREDO DACO GANADEN It's a great sorrow to announce the passing of our dad Mr. Alfredo Daco Ganaden who passed away peacefully at Seven Oaks Hospital on August 17, 2011 at 7:15 p.m. Alfredo is survived by his children: daughter Zenaida (David) Bjornson; sons, Jerry (Susie), Ric (Gloria), Freddie (Alma), Rey (Lizette) and Ben (Lisa); grandchildren, Bobby (Mary), Navarro, Bernice (Michael), Valerie (Joe), Paul, Jon Paul Sacha, Rachel, Chelsea, Jessica, Jericho, Chase and Capri; great-grandchildren, Cole and twins, Alyssa and Mia. Alfredo is predeceased by his beloved wife of 66 years, Teofila Fely Gorospe Ganaden; son Jose Ganaden; daughter Evelyn G. Navarro; Alfredo's sisters - Dolores, Andrea Cavanas, Florentina Ganaden, Crony Heights and Luisa Pecson. Our father attended University of the Philippines. He was a businessman in Baguio City, Philippines. Dad, jointly with our mom, managed a very successful construction company, school supplies, beauty parlour and a taxi business which enabled them to put all their children through university. Dad enjoyed playing the piano (he learned to play by ear), watching boxing, basketball and tennis on TV. Dad was a very gifted painter both recreational painting as a hobby and commercial sign painting - painting portraits of Queen Elizabeth, Wayne Gretzky and Pope John Paul II and beautiful landscape pieces. Dad was a very smart, hard working man who provided well for his children. He worked many years of his life in our taxi business in the 1960s and the 1970s and as a sign painter in the 1980s and 1990s. Dad was a very firm, simple, no nonsense and always used his common sense type of a man.
